- The distance between Damascus (Intl), Syria and Athens, Greece is approximately 1,263 km or 785 mi.
- To reach Damascus (Intl) in this distance one would set out from Athens bearing 109.9°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Damascus (Intl) bearing 117.4° or ESE .
- Damascus (Intl) has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Athens has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Damascus (Intl) is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Athens is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 1 °C (1.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.7 °C (4.9°F) more in Damascus (Intl). The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 232.5 mm (9.2 in) less which is equivalent to 232.5 l/m² (5.71 US gal/ft²) or 2,325,000 l/ha (248,558 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.6° higher in Damascus (Intl) than in Athens.
